21.had better, would rather 后跟不帶to的不定式。
    F:You had better to pay attention to the details.
    T:You had better pay attention to the details.
    F:I had better not to play tennis this afternoon.
    T:I had better not play tennis this afternoon.
    F:Which movie would you rather to see?
    T:Which movie would you rather see?
    F:She says that she would rather not to have dessert.
    T:She says that she would rather not have dessert.
    22.In,into,In意指location within.Into指motion or direction。
    F:She stepped carefully in the car.
    T:She stepped carefully into the car.
    F:He jumped off his bicycle and ran in the library.
    T:He jumped off his bicycle and ran into the library.
    23.in regards to為誤用, 應(yīng)說in regard to,as regards, 或 regarding.
    F:I am writing in regards to your letter of May 10.
    T:I am writing in regard to (or as regards, regarding) your letter of May 10.
    24.in spite of,despite都是介詞,后面不跟從句。
    F:I was able to concentrate despite the room was noisy.
    T:1 was able to concentrate despite the noisy room.
    F:Tn spite of it was cold, he didn't wear a coat.
    T:In spite of the cold, he didn't wear a coat.
    25.Its,it's;Its是代詞所屬格,It's 是 it is的縮略式。
    F:Us essential that we leave on time.
    T:It's essential that we leave on time.
    F:The human body and it's organs are interesting to study.
    T:The human body and its organs are interesting to study.
    F:The dog wagged -it's tail when it saw the food.
    T:The dog wagged its tail when it saw the food.
    26.kind,sort,和type都是單數(shù),只能被單數(shù)形容詞修飾,其復(fù)數(shù)形式分別是kinds,sorts,和types.
    F:You should avoid making these kind of mistakes.
    T:You should avoid making these kinds of mistakes.
    OR
    You should avoid making this kind of mistake.
    F:Those kind of insects are harmful to man.
    T:Those kinds of insects are harmful to man.
    OR
    That kind of insect is harmful to man.
    27.kind of a,sort of a,type of a.省略a。
    F:What kind of a telephone did the company install?
    T:What kind of telephone did the company install?
    F:The vicuna is a shy type of an animal.
    T:The vicuna is a shy type of animal.

    29.lay,lie.lay帶賓語,lie 不帶賓語。
    F:I always lay down after I eat dinner.
    T:I always lie down after I eat dinner, (present tense)
    F:He laid down because he had a headache.
    T:He lay down because he had a headache, (past tense)
    F:The books are laying on the table.
    T:The books are lying on the table, (present participle-)
    F:The teacher lay her books on the table when she entered the room.
    T:The teacher laid her books on the table when she entered the room, (past tense)
    F:The boys have laid under the trees for hours.
    T:The boys have Iain under the trees for hours, (present participle)
    30.lend,loan.Lend是動(dòng)詞;loan是名詞。
    F:Would you mind loaning me your pencil?
    T:Would you mind lending me your pencil?
    F:I needed money, so John loaned me some.
    T:I needed money, so John lent me some.
